Output 380026304b232bf9407615e6bd90d1d31c24d913869217dfbada57274935bdf9:0

value
10700
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 82ca3d1400adbb2bd29a6f3010f67c3bf63e32a57344c20aab8c457c0e2ebd3f
address
ltc1pst9r69qq4kajh556ducppanu80mruv49wdzvyz4t33zhcr3wh5lsc57dlh
transaction
380026304b232bf9407615e6bd90d1d31c24d913869217dfbada57274935bdf9
spent
true